() 해외배송 가능
도서의 특징 |
이 책 한권으로 PHP를 친근하게 느끼는 계기가 되었으면 합니다.
이 책은 PHP나 프로그래밍의 기초를 배우고자 하는 초보자용으로, 문장보다는 이미지를 전면에 내세워 설명하고 있습니다. 캐릭터 베이스의 프로그램을 작성함으로써 PHP의 개념의 확실한 이해 도모를 목적으로 하고 있습니다. 그리고 일러스트와 그림을 많이 사용하고 있으므로 단순히 문장으로만 설명하는 것보다 이미지 전달이 더 정확하리라고 생각합니다. 이번에 새롭게 개정되어 선보인 〈PHP가 보이는 그림책〉의 개정증보판은 그림책 시리즈의 명성에 걸맞게 프로그래밍 공부를 시작하려는 모든 이들에게 길잡이 역할을 제대로 해줄 것입니다. 이런 분들에게 추천합니다! - PHP를 처음으로 공부하는 분 - 알고 있는 것 같지만 이해가 잘 되지 않는 분 - 공부를 하다가 도중에 포기했던 분
상세이미지 |
목차 |
제0장 PHP를 시작하기 전에
PHP란?
WWW의 구조
HTML- 정적인 페이지
CGI - 동적인 페이지
서버 사이드 스크립트
PHP의 환경구축
제1장 기본적인 프로그램
keypoint 프로그램 토대 만들기
keypoint 문자 표시부터
● Hello World!
● PHP로 값을 출력해 보기
● HTML의 기초
● 폼
● 폼 부품
● 데이터 받기
〈〈 Exercise 도전! PHP
PHP상식 프로그램을 제작할 때의 약속
제2장 변수와 배열
keypoint 데이터를 보관하는 상자
keypoint 프로그램을 간단하게
● 변수
● 변수에 저장된 값 표시
● 데이터 형
● 문자열 (1)
● 문자열 (2)
● 형의 변환
● 형의 판정
● 배열 (1)
● 배열 (2)
● 배열의 활용
● 레퍼런스(Reference)
● 상수 (1)
● 상수 (2)
● 미리 정의된 변수
〈〈 Exercise 도전! PHP
PHP상식 환경변수
제3장 연산자
keypoint 컴퓨터가 계산기 대용으로!
keypoint 컴퓨터가 아니면 불가능한 연산
● 산술 연산자 (1)
● 산술 연산자 (2)
● 비교 연산자
● 배열 연산자
● 논리 연산자
● 조건 연산자
● 기타 연산자
● 연산자의 우선순위
● 수학 함수
〈〈 Exercise 도전! PHP
PHP상식 복잡한 논리 연산
제4장 제어문
keypoint 프로그램의 흐름을 바꿔 보자!
● if문 (1)
● if문 (2)
● for문
● foreach문
● while문
● 루프의 중단 (1)
● 루프의 중단 (2)
● switch문
예제프로그램 거스름돈을 계산한다
〈〈 Exercise 도전! PHP
PHP상식 goto문~
제5장 함수
keypoint 마법의 블랙박스
keypoint 실용적인 프로그램에 내딛는 첫걸음
● 함수의 정의
● 함수 호출하기
● 인수 전달방법
● 가변 길이 인수
● 인수의 형 선언
● 다양한 반환값
● 다른 파일의 삽입
● 변수의 스코프
● 익명함수
예제프로그램 별자리를 표시한다
〈〈 Exercise 도전! PHP
PHP상식 함수를 사용한 가변 길이 인수
제6장 문자열 조작
keypoint 정규표현이란 무엇인가?
keypoint 문자열 조작
● 정규표현이란?
● 메타 문자 (1)
● 메타 문자 (2)
● 여러 가지 정규표현 (1)
● 여러 가지 정규표현 (2)
● 문자열 함수 (1)
● 문자열 함수 (2)
● 문자열 함수 (3)
예제프로그램 패스워드 형식을 조사한다
예제프로그램 날짜를 다른 포맷으로 변환한다
〈〈 Exercise 도전! PHP
PHP상식 정규표현 퀴즈
제7장 인터넷과의 연계
keypoint 쿠키란 무엇일까?
keypoint 에러의 처리
● 세션
● 쿠키
● 세션 관리 (1)
● 세션 관리 (2)
● 파일 업로드
● 에러와 예외 처리 (1)
● 에러와 예외 처리 (2)
● 어서션
예제프로그램 방문 횟수 카운터
〈〈 Exercise 도전! PHP
PHP상식 헤더 정보
제8장 데이터 관리
keypoint 파일이란 무엇일까?
keypoint 파일을 다루는 데는 순서가 있다
keypoint 데이터베이스란?
● 파일 핸들
● 텍스트 파일 읽기
● 텍스트 파일 쓰기
● 파일 검사와 조작
● 데이터베이스 SQLite
● 테이블 작성
● 데이터 등록
● 데이터 취득 (1)
● 데이터 취득 (2)
● 데이터의 갱신과 삭제
예제프로그램 게시판을 작성하기
예제프로그램 앙케트를 작성하기
〈〈 Exercise 도전! PHP
PHP상식 파일 잠금
부록 좀 더 힘내 볼까요?
● 숫자와 단위
● 문자 인코딩
● 전자메일 보내기
● 이름 공간
● 제네레이터
● 클래스
● PEAR과 PECL
● 커맨드 라인으로 사용한다
● 파일 속성
● 폼 부품 목록
● 예약어와 $_FILES 일람
● XAMPP 설치하기
● PEAR 설치하기
용어 설명 모음
찾아보기
* 배송마감 : 평일 오후 5시까지 입금확인시 당일발송됩니다.
* 배송기간 : 입금확인후 1~2일(제주도 등은 2~3일)
* 품절 등의 사유로 배송이 1~2일 정도 지연될 수 있습니다.
* 일부 테이프나 플레이디스크, 또는 신간이 나와있는 도서의 구판 등
재고를 가지고 있지 않은경우는 입고되어 발송해드리는 경우가 있습니다.
이때에는 배송일이 2~3일 소요될 수 있습니다.
* 예약판매도서 안내
교환 및 반품이 가능한 경우
- 상품을 공급 받으신 날로부터 5일이내 단, 포장을 개봉하였거나 포장이 훼손되어 상품가치가 상실된 경우에는 교환/반품이 불가능합니다.
- 공급받으신 상품이 주문내용과 다른 경우
교환 및 반품이 불가능한 경우
- 고객님의 책임 있는 사유로 상품등이 멸실 또는 훼손된 경우. 단, 상품의 내용을 확인하기 위하여
포장 등을 훼손한 경우는 제외
- 테이프, 플레이디스크, 서브종류 등은 상품특성상 교환 및 반품이 불가능합니다.
- 복제가 가능한 상품등의 포장을 훼손한 경우
(자세한 내용은 고객만족센터 02)812-9070 , 1:1 E-MAIL상담을 이용해 주시기 바랍니다.)
- 도서의 스프링 제본 선택시 교환, 반품, 환불이 불가능합니다.
※ 고객님의 마음이 바뀌어 교환, 반품을 하실 경우 상품반송 비용은 고객님께서 부담하셔야 합니다.